Migration Step 4: Enable Offline Mode (Fernhollow Surveyor)

Upgrade clients to 3.2 before flipping the flag. Offline capture queues survey entries locally and syncs when connectivity returns; conflict resolution is last-write-wins per field. Purge stale local caches first or sync will reject mixed-schema batches. Roll out region by region. Apply the following configuration to each deployment.

deployment values, hawep-hawep:
RALAX_PIN=0900
RALAX_TENANT=sildor
RALAX_METRICS_HOST=metrics.ralax.xolmardata.example
RALAX_SEAL=seal_87e42d77
RALAX_STANDBY_TEAM=briius

**Release checklist — item 7: retrying failed exports**

Before sign-off, verify the Greymarsh export queue drains cleanly. Trigger three deliberate failures via the staging toggle, then confirm each retries with exponential backoff and lands in the dead-letter bin after the fourth attempt. Do not clear the bin manually; the Oxholt reconciler reads it overnight. If any export retries more than four times, stop and escalate rather than patching live. Record the candidate build token shown below.

session token of tajef-bageg = htk21_5d90d574934f3ccae6437

Subject: Telemetry compression handoff

Hey on-call folks — heads up that the gzip-to-zstd migration for Pulsewick telemetry payloads has a new owner. If the compressor ratio alarms fire or the decoder starts rejecting frames, page the new owner, not me. Runbook is unchanged. The responsible engineer is named below.

approver of bagug-bagag = Holael Pramir